Output 3b651107d23e9789986fcf0343ee74de8b7214c2315898e5993103d522e0a94d:1

value
11314236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db6c0e2f428349b277509c2bccaa01efacb44603 OP_EQUALVERIFY OP_CHECKSIG
address
1M1CRqGmhig1yd8RDqBHrUj4kUXofpP7rx
transaction
3b651107d23e9789986fcf0343ee74de8b7214c2315898e5993103d522e0a94d
spent
true